Preview textWe sailed out on a very sunny day, and in about 30 minutes, we spotted a rare visitor to our bay - 2 fin whales - the second largest animal in the world! Another blow nearby turned out to be a humpback whale and also close by was a big pod of white-beaked dolphins! On our afternoon tour, we sailed out again and spotted a humpback whale again, and the same 2 fin whales nearby! We spent some time before carrying on, and found 2 humpback whales and over 200 white-beaked dolphins in a feeding frenzy! An absolutely INCREDIBLE day!

Preview textWe headed out with some wind and swell, and ventured into Hvalfjörður to see what we could find. We soon spotted 10 white-beaked dolphins speeding around and chasing fish, a great sighting! On the way home, we also spotted 5 harbour porpoises closer to Reykjavik. The wind had picked up even more in the afternoon, so we decided to cancel our 13:00 tour for the safety and comfort of our passengers.

Preview textIt felt like a summer day today with blue skies as we headed out for a morning tour. We first spotted a minke whale, the second time we have spotted one in 2026. We spent some time admiring this minke before spotting 7 harbour porpoises. In the afternoon, we again headed out and had very brief sightings of a minke whale and 5 harbour porpoises but since the sightings were very short, we gave our guests complimentary tickets to try their luck again.
